jsp建站模板是什么?
发布日期:2023-05-28 18:05:10浏览次数:664
初探JSP建站模板
在网站建设中,无论是企业官网还是个人博客,都需要模板来统一页面风格,提高用户体验。而JSP建站模板是一个由JavaServer Pages技术实现的可复用网站模板。
JSP建站模板特点
JSP建站模板具有以下几个特点:
- 原生代码:JSP建站模板代码类似HTML,易于理解和维护;
- 动态内容:JSP模板可以嵌入Java代码,实现动态展示内容;
- 易于拓展:通过封装和继承等技术,可以快速增加新的页面和功能;
- 良好兼容性:JSP模板可以运行在各种Java Web容器中,比如Tomcat、Jetty等。
如何使用JSP建站模板
使用JSP建站模板需要以下步骤:
- 选用合适的JSP模板:可以选择市面上已有的模板或自己编写新的模板;
- 创建网站页面:根据需求创建HTML页面并将JSP代码嵌入其中;
- 开发Java逻辑:根据业务需求编写后台Java代码,实现数据交互、数据处理等功能;
- 用Web容器部署网站:将JSP页面、Java代码打包成WAR文件,并部署在Web容器中,完成网站搭建。
的JSP模板案例
市面上有很多的JSP建站模板,比如FreeMarker、Velocity、Thymeleaf。下面以FreeMarker为例介绍一下其应用情况。
FreeMarker是一款模板引擎,与JSP类似,但具有更高的可扩展性和可移植性。它使用独立的模板语言,具有较高的渲染速度和灵活性。
FreeMarker常用于Java Web开发中,支持JSP扩展标签的使用。同时,由于其开源、易用、高效的特点,被越来越多的企业和个人所接受和应用。
JSP网站建设项目实战
在实际项目中,JSP的应用是比较广泛的。下面详细介绍一下JSP网站建设的实战操作流程。
项目需求分析
在进行任何一个项目之前,我们都需要进行需求分析。在JSP网站建设中,需求分析包括以下方面:
- 网站类型:确定网站类型,比如企业官网、电商网站等;
- 功能需求:根据网站类型确定各种功能需求,比如登录注册、商品展示、支付等;
- 页面设计:根据企业形象和用户体验等要素,设计出网站页面框架和样式;
- 数据处理:确定数据来源和交互方式,实现数据的获取和处理。
网站搭建流程
在完成需求分析后,我们就可以开始着手进行网站搭建了。JSP网站搭建流程一般包括以下几个步骤:
- 建立项目:通过Eclipse等开发工具创建一个Java Web项目,并创建Web Pages目录;
- 编写JSP页面:根据需求设计JSP页面,可以使用HTML、CSS和JavaScript等技术;
- 编写Java代码:实现页面的数据获取和处理等功能,也可以将Java代码放在JSP页面中;
- 配置Web.xml:对Web容器进行必要的配置,比如Servlet和Filter的映射等;
- 运行测试:将项目打包为WAR文件,并部署在Web容器中进行测试和调试。
开发注意事项
JSP网站开发虽然是比较灵活的,但也有一些需要注意的细节问题。以下是几点建议:
- 代码规范:JSP建站模板代码需要遵循编码规范,便于后期维护和修改;
- 安全性:JSP网站要保证数据传输的安全性,比如使用HTTPS等加密协议;
- 可扩展性:JSP网站要考虑到后期功能的拓展性,可以采用封装和继承等技术实现;
- 效率问题:JSP程序要注意性能问题,避免出现较慢的页面响应等情况。
通过本文的介绍,我们对JSP建站模板和JSP网站开发有了更深入的了解,可以把握项目需求和实战操作流程,更有效地完成JSP网站建设。